Discuss the various defenses to the tort of negligence.
 
  What will be an ideal response?

Answer to Question 1

Answer should include discussion of assumption of risk (walking on a known slippery, icy sidewalk), comparative negligence and contributory negligence (plaintiff somehow contributed to own injury), states have one defense or the other, and superseding event (defendant claims something else happened to truly cause plaintiff's injury).
